48-year-old man found in Bird Rock, 2nd body found in five days
Another man was found dead in the Bird Rock area, St. Kitts. This time, on Monday Dec. 16th.
A police spokesperson told the VONNEWSLINE that officers responded to reports of an unpleasant odour emanating from a residence in Bird Rock. Upon investigation, 48-yr old Justin Hobson was found deceased. An autopsy will be conducted to ascertain the cause of death.
It comes following the death of Cleon Maxwell “Bougna” Rey of St. Johnston’s Village, who was also found in Bird Rock on Wednesday Dec. 11th.
He was found laying motionless in the foliage a short distance from his vehicle. He was examined and pronounced deceased at the scene.
Meanwhile, an autopsy conducted on Monday Dec. 16th, concluded that there was no foul play involved in Mr. Rey’s death, which translates into no crime being committed that led to his death. However, his death was classified as an unnatural death.
